SuperSport agree deal to sign Wits' Keene

Cape Town - SuperSport United have agreed a deal to sign Bidvest Wits striker James Keene to boost their striking department after the departure of Jeremy Brockie.

Sport24 has learned that Keene, 32, whose contract comes to an end at the end of the current 2017/18 Absa Premiership season, has agreed to join Matsatsantsa after not being offered a new deal by the Clever Boys.

Wits recently signed striker Thobani Mncwango from Polokwane City while adding Lehlohonolo Majoro from Cape Town City as the struggling league champions go in search of much-needed goals.

Keene reportedly grew frustrated at not being offered a new deal at Wits with team-mates Nazeer Allie and attacker Eleazar Rodgers also in the final six months of their contracts.

Having released and sold several players, including top striker Jeremy Brockie to Sundowns, Eric Tinkler has conceded that he needs to go into  the transfer market.

However, the former Bafana Bafana midfielder says he may be forced to look to the continent for signings as he feels PSL players are often over-priced.

"We are thin at the moment. We are very thin. Obviously, a striker (is a priority), right now we have Kingston (Nkhatha) and a young boy Darren Smith (who are fit), and that's too much pressure to put onto the young man to be honest," Tinkler told the media.

"We are fairly close (to signing a new player), I don't want to mention names yet because like I said that process is still in negotiations and I don't want things to be changing last minute and look like an idiot because I told you this one is coming in and it doesn't happen.

SuperSport who are currently languishing in 13th position in the standings next face AmaZulu in a league clash at the Lucas Moripe Stadium on Wednesday.

Kick-off is at 19:30.
